6.2Pre-conditioning
6.2.1 One test sample shall be subjected to the following pre-conditioning conditions in sequence prior totesting in 6.3 and 6.4, as applicable:
a) Stress Relief Test – A product with an enclosure,battery compartment doorlcover or batterycompartment doorlcover opening mechanism made of molded or formed thermoplastic materialsshall be subjected to a stress relief test.A sample of the complete product is to be placed in acirculating air oven for a period of 7 h. The oven temperature is to be set to the higher of (1) or (2)below.After removal from the oven, the sample is permitted to cool to room temperature.
1)70°C(158°F); or
2)10°℃ (18°F) higher than the maximum temperature of thermoplastic enclosures, batterycompartment doorlcovers, or battery compartment doorlcover mechanisms during the moststringent normal operation of the device.
b) Battery Replacement Test -The battery compartment doorlcover shall be opened and closed,and the battery removed and replaced, for a total of ten cycles. The process shall simulatereplacement according to the manufacturer’s instructions. lf the battery compartment is securedwith a screw (s), the screw (s) is to be loosened and then tightened by means of a suitablescrewdriver, applying a continuous linear torque according to the Torque to be Applied to Screwstable,Table 20, of the Standard for Audio,Video and Similar Electronic Apparatus – SafetyRequirements, UL6O065.
6.3Abuse tests
6.3.1General
6.3.1.1 The tests in 6.3.2- 6.3.4 shall be performed sequentially, as applicable, on one pre-conditionedsample of the product. After all test conditions have been completed, compliance is checked by 6.3.5.
6.3.2Drop test for portable devices
6.3.2.1 Portable devices are subjected to drop tests from a height of 1.0 m (39.4 in) onto a horizontalhardwood surface in positions likely to produce the maximum force on the battery compartment orenclosure.Portable devices are subjected to three drops, except hand-held products are subjected to tendrops.The hardwood surface shall be at least 13-mm (1/2-in) thick, mounted on two layers of nominal 19-mm (3/4-in) thick plywood, placed on a concrete or equivalent non-resilient surface.
6.3.3 lmpact test
6.3.3.1 The enclosure or battery compartment doorlcover shall be subject to three,2-J (1.5-ft lbf)impacts. This impact is to be produced by dropping a steel sphere, 50.8 mm (2 inches) in diameter, andweighing approximately 0.5 kg (1.1 lb) from the height required to produce the specified impact, as shownin Figure 6.1, or the steel sphere is to be suspended by a cord and swung as a pendulum, droppingthrough the vertical distance required to cause it to strike the surface with the specified impact as shown inFigure 6.2.
